A driveway in Bethalto, IL, was sinking and needed to be addressed. The homeowner decide to give Woods a call. To solve this issue, PolyLevel™ was used to level the concrete driveway. By drilling pea-sized holes into the concrete and injecting a polyurethane foam underneath, the foam is able to expand to lift and level the concrete slabs. This product is great for driveways because it hardens within hours. With this system in place, the homeowner can rest easy knowing their driveway is in great shape!

A sidewalk in Bethalto, IL was unleveled and dealing with large seams. This needed to be addressed, so the homeowners decided to give Woods Basement Systems a call. To solve this issue, PolyLevel™ was used to level the concrete. This system works by drilling pea-sized holes into the concrete and injecting a polyurethane foam underneath. The foam then expands to lift and level the concrete slabs. This foam hardens to become rock solid within hours, so the homeowner can use their sidewalk later that same day. Next, NexusPro™ was used to seal the seams. This flexible sealant will withstand any harsh weather the homeowner may receive, as it is very durable. With these systems in place, the homeowner can now rest easy knowing their sidewalk is in great shape!
This Red Bud, Illinois homeowner was trying to keep their basement dry with two sump pumps. When the second pedestal pump would have to kick on it would often dance around in the pump pit and deactivate the swich on the other pump. Our TripleSafe® sump pump pit holds up to three pumps. In this case only two pumps were installed to meet the homeowners needs. They especially liked that the second pump was elevated on a pump stand that held the pump in place and only activated the pump when there were high water levels in the sump pump pit.
Lanetta A. was surprised when she discovered water was entering her home's crawl space after big rain storms. She knew standing water could cause problems such as rotting and mold growth, so she called Woods Basement Systems.
Design specialist John S. assessed the problem and decided the best solution was to install a CleanSpace encapsulation system, a SmartPipe drainage system, a SmartSump sump pump, and a Sanidry Sedona dehumidifier. Foreman James L. then headed to the home to start the job.
The CleanSpace encapsulation system was placed on the floors and up the walls of the crawl space. This heavy duty and durable liner acts as a vapor barrier and drains any leaks that might occur behind the CleanSpace.
